Anita Rani Launching ‘Sisters Of Defiance’ Podcast With Guests Including Gisele Pelicot
Anita Rani is set to launch her podcast, 'Sisters of Defiance,' through her production company, Illuminaunty Productions. The podcast will feature notable guests, including Gisèle Pelicot and Anoushka Shankar, discussing themes of defiance and resilience. The first episode is scheduled to be released on May 26.

Anita Rani Illuminaunty Productions EXCLUSIVE: British broadcaster and presenter Anita Rani is launching a podcast, Sisters of Defiance, next week through her new production house, Illuminaunty Productions. The series will include guests such as Gisèle Pelicot, the French woman who waived her right to anonymity in one of the most horrifying rape cases in history to stand in solidarity with fellow victims. Also lined up are 13-time Grammy nominee Anoushka Shankar, entrepreneur and CEO Emma Grede, comedy actress Meera Syal and comedian Fatiha El-Ghorri. Sisters of Defiance will see Rani, host of BBC Radio 4 series Women’s Hour and TV show Countryfile, sitting down with women who have had to push themselves beyond conventional limits.
